No I just didn't realize it was going to be 5 dives, although I'm sure it would be fun as I loved the first time around. What's a scuba unit btw?
It’s done over one weekend at Dutch Seings and it’s a lot of fun!
if weather is nice we camp BBqing and hangout.
scuba unit would include regulator,BCD ( buoyancy compensator device) air tank and weights and don’t forget you need 7mm wetsuit. Lol
All of this you can rent at SNY you have to own Mask snorkel boots fins and gloves. This is called personal gear.

I am sorry to hear that
But it happens quite often with rental gear.
this days gear is more affordable and technology really improved.
to be cert require swim only 200 yards. That’s nothing to compare when you take Divemaster and instructor!
400 yards swim no mask and fins
800 yards with mask and fins and it’s timed.
